British Dependency Thrilled Fans In Florida


British Dependency kicked off their 14 City tour in Orlando, Florida to rave reviews at the famed, House of Blues. Since releasing their debut album, "Finding Wisdom," the band has been raking in new fans and causing fellow musicians to pause and take a closer look.

Quipped with drum, bass and guitar, the band stormed through Orlando' House of Blues bringing with them some much needed heat. The sold out venue was abuzz on Friday, January 10th as the trio stormed the stage and thrilled fans with selections such as "Selah," "Do You This," "Haiti," and "One."

Their 35 minute set had the audience dancing and cheering them on with each note and verse. Joyah dazzled on the bass while Ruel showcased his skills on the guitar and Jaiden, the drums. It was preview of what was to come.  

On Saturday, January 11th the band performed at the Palladium Theatre in Clearwater, Florida and they brought the same energy and grit to their set. After the show the band greeted fans, took pictures and signed copies of their album. Pumped from the feedback of fans the band arrived in Jacksonville a couple of days ahead of their performance at Freebrid Live to rehearse and conduct radio interviews. 

Then on Tuesday, January 14th they rocked the house. The band represented Anguilla well talking to fans about the support they have received thus far from the Anguilla Tourist Board and fellow Anguillans. Tarrus Riley Set To Release 'Love Situation'‏ Album


On February 4, 2014 world renowned reggae crooner Tarrus Riley will release Love Situation, his fifth full length album. The 17-track collection is produced by Dean Fraser for Cannon, assisted by talents such as Shane C. Brown of Juke Boxx Productions, Mitchum "Khan" Chin and Jordan McClure.

The project was mixed by Shane C. Brown & Romel Marshall and was mastered by Grammy award winning engineer Michael Fuller. The album will be available January 28th for pre-order and officially released February 4th on iTunes and a variety of online retailers, as well as physical CD's in digipak format. To promote the album Tarrus will be kicking off a US tour on January 25th.
